ZIP 07310 Foreclosure, Tax-Lien & Distress Report

Hudson County, New Jersey · High Value market

Composite property distress in 07310 (Hudson County, New Jersey) lands at 25/100 — low on DLRadar's public-record scoring. Its heaviest discrete signals: structural risk (55/100), construction/permit lag (37/100), institutional ownership (20/100). On the quiet end sit institutional ownership (20/100) and mortgage stress (8/100). The split runs 55/100 structural to 2/100 active on the ground. Climate and flood risk are elevated too — climate & FEMA risk (96/100), flood (NFIP) exposure (89/100).

The market reads expansion — home values rose 5.2% year on year, at 35/100 phase confidence. Appreciation rarely lifts every parcel — the laggards are the opportunity.

Around 29% of renters are cost-burdened. There are about 8,587 housing units across 07310. On demographic stress specifically, 07310 scores 33/100. Around 88%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. At $172,946, median income runs above typical U.S. levels. Vacancy runs 9.7%. Home values center near $844,400, an affordability ratio of 5.1×. 14,577 residents call 07310 home, typically aged 31. 12.2% of residents fall below the poverty threshold. Owners hold 11% of homes, renters 89%.
